APPENDIX.

I.

ABSTRACT of the present REVENUES of the
TWO HOSPITALS.

BRIDEWELL.

Annual Revenue.

£.s.d.

Effects in Bridewell Precinct,1199 3 6
in Wapping,2642 10 6
in Holborn and Fleet-street,206 16 6
in Oxfordshire,182 0 0
Annuities from Royal Hospital, Parishes, and Public Companies96 15 0
Dr. Tyson's £.50.payable every 5 Years 1-5th (which expires at Christmas 804) 10 0 0
£.3550. 3 per Cent. East India Annuities,106 10 0
£.3300. 3 per Cent. Reduced Annuities,99 0 0
4542 15 6
Legacies, Benefactions, and casual Receipts, which amounted in 1791 to 385 7 10
4929 3 4
Deductions from the Rental for Quit Rents and Insurances as per 1791, 422 10 3
Total of BRIDEWELL, 4505 13 1

BETHLEM.

Estates in Lincoln shire (for Incurables)1871 17 0
at Charing Cross and St. Martin's Lane234 10 0
in Old Bethlem304 2 0
in Round Court, Vine Street8 0 0
in Bishopsgate Street66 0 0
at Shepherd's Bush62 0 0
in Lime Street Square250 17 0
in Riches Court and Lime Street222 19 0
in kent,636 12 0
at Mile End0 5 0
in Fowkes's Court, Tower Street168 2 0
Annuities from Royal Hospitals and Public Companies,52 14 3
Dr. Tyson £.50. payable every 5 Years 1-5th (which expires at Christmas 1804) 10 0 0
£.3500. New South Sea Annuities105 0 0
700. Ditto (for Incurables)21 0 0
2000. Orphan Stock80 0 0
3800. Ditto (for Incurables)152 0 0
12000. Bank Annuities 1726,360 0 0
2000. Old South Sea Annuities60 0 0
6250. Three per Cent. Consols187 10 0
6250 Ditto (for Incurables).187 10 0
750. East India Annuities for ditto,22 10 0
100. Three per Cent. Reduced Annuities,3 0 0
Carried over 5072 8 3

62 APPENDIX.

Brought over, 5072 8 3
Contingencies for Cloathing, Etc. which amounted in 1791 to2365 16 1
Legacies and Benefactionsditto589 17 0
8028 1 4
Deductions from the Rental for Quit Rents, Etc, as per 1791,146 1 5½
Total of BETHLEM,7881 19 10½

Of which REVENUES the following belong to the INCURABLE Fund,


The Lincolnshire Estateproducing 1871 17 0
£. 700. New South Sea Annuities,21 0 0
3800. Orphan Stock,152 0 0
6250. Three per Cent. Consols,187 10 0
750. East India Annuities22 10 0
2254 17 0
And. £.1000. more East India Annuities ; which the Select Committee
judge should be added to the above,
30 0 0
Annual Income2284 17 0
